If you’re diving into the world of photo editing, whether as a newbie or a seasoned pro, you’re tapping into a service that blends creativity with technical skill. A photo edit service covers everything from basic color correction and retouching to complex manipulations and compositing. Beginners often start with simpler tasks such as cropping, adjusting brightness, or fixing blemishes. These fundamentals build your confidence and portfolio while getting you comfortable with popular tools like Adobe Photoshop or Lightroom. Meanwhile, experienced editors might focus on high-end beauty retouching, background transformations, or creating commercial-ready images for advertising and e-commerce.

Delivering top-notch photo editing isn’t just about clicking a few buttons; it’s a craft that requires a structured workflow and mastery of the right tools. Typically, a photo edit service workflow begins with a clear understanding of the client's requirements—knowing exactly what they expect is crucial to avoid revisions that eat up your time.
First, you receive the raw images and assess their quality and the edits needed. This evaluation guides the techniques and software you'll use. Tools like Adobe Photoshop and Lightroom dominate the scene, but alternatives such as Capture One or Affinity Photo can serve niche needs or budgets. It’s wise to be flexible; some clients may prefer specific software formats.
Next, you perform initial corrections: exposure, white balance, cropping, and removing obvious flaws. For beginners, mastering these basics ensures your edits look natural. Professionals often go beyond, applying layer masks, frequency separation, and advanced color grading to refine the image. Keep your layers organized — it saves time and allows easy adjustments if clients request changes.
Practical advice: Develop presets or action scripts for repetitive tasks like batch color correction. This boosts your productivity and keeps quality consistent across multiple photos — a major plus when handling e-commerce or event shoots with many images.
Quality control is non-negotiable. Before delivery, conduct a zoomed-in inspection for artifacts, unnatural edges, or color imbalances. A second pair of eyes, maybe a fellow freelancer on Insolvo, can be invaluable. It reduces revisions and builds client trust.
Communication matters just as much as technical skills. Clarify deadlines, deliver formats, and expected revisions upfront. Clients appreciate transparency, which, in turn, protects you from scope creep and unpaid work.
Lastly, keeping your tools updated and investing time in learning new editing trends keeps your service competitive. For example, AI-powered features in recent software versions can speed up tedious tasks — from sky replacement to automatic masking.
